"David e Bersabea" is an oratorio composed by Nicola Porpora, an Italian composer of the Baroque era. The oratorio was composed in 1724 and premiered in Rome in the same year. It is a sacred drama that tells the story of King David's love for Bathsheba and the consequences of his actions. The oratorio is divided into three movements, each with its own distinct character and musical style. The first movement is a lament, in which David expresses his sorrow and regret for his actions. The music is slow and mournful, with long, flowing melodies and rich harmonies. The second movement is a dialogue between David and Nathan the Prophet, who confronts David about his sin. The music is more dramatic and intense, with sharp, angular melodies and dissonant harmonies that reflect the tension between the two characters. The third movement is a chorus that celebrates the forgiveness of David and the mercy of God. The music is joyful and exuberant, with lively rhythms and bright, colorful harmonies that reflect the sense of relief and redemption that the characters feel. Overall, "David e Bersabea" is a powerful and emotional work that showcases Porpora's skill as a composer. The music is rich and expressive, with a wide range of styles and moods that capture the drama and intensity of the story. It remains a popular work in the Baroque repertoire and is often performed in concert and on recordings.
